Understanding the Sphere Venue Concept
The Sphere is a groundbreaking venue concept that emphasizes immersive audiovisual experiences. Unlike traditional arenas, the Sphere employs a spherical design that envelops the audience in a 360-degree environment, utilizing massive LED displays both inside and outside the structure. This design aims to deliver unparalleled visual immersion, making the audience feel as though they are part of the performance itself.
One of the most recognized examples is the MSG Sphere in Las Vegas, which opened in 2023. With a capacity of approximately 17,500 seats, this venue combines architectural innovation with state-of-the-art technology to create a unique concert-going experience. The spherical shape allows for a wraparound LED display system that covers the interior dome, providing high-resolution visuals visible from every seat. The venue’s exterior is equally impressive, featuring a dynamic LED skin that can display a variety of visuals, from artistic graphics to advertisements, transforming the Sphere into a landmark that captivates both visitors and locals alike.

Technical Specifications of Sphere LED Displays
The LED technology used in Sphere venues is among the most advanced in the industry. For instance, the MSG Sphere features an interior LED display that spans approximately 160,000 square feet, with a pixel pitch as fine as 2.5 millimeters. This tight pixel pitch ensures crisp, clear images even when viewed up close, which is essential given the proximity of seats to the display surface. The advanced calibration and color accuracy of these panels mean that artists can rely on the visuals to enhance their performances, ensuring that every detail is rendered beautifully, from the subtle nuances of a performer’s expression to the vibrant colors of elaborate stage designs.
Additionally, the Sphere’s exterior is also covered with LED panels, creating a massive digital canvas visible from miles away. This exterior display serves both as an artistic statement and a promotional tool, displaying event information, advertisements, or thematic visuals that set the tone for the event. Balancing Screen Size and Seating Density
One of the primary challenges is balancing the size and placement of LED screens with the number of seats. Larger screens require more structural support and space, which can reduce the available area for seating. However, the immersive nature of the displays means that even seats further from the stage can offer a compelling visual experience, allowing venues to distribute seating more evenly around the sphere rather than concentrating it near a traditional stage.
This distribution can increase overall capacity by utilizing space that might otherwise be less desirable in conventional venues. The wraparound screen design also reduces the need for large video boards or multiple screens, streamlining the venue layout.

MSG Sphere Las Vegas
The MSG Sphere in Las Vegas is a flagship example, boasting a seating capacity of around 17,500. Its interior LED display covers the entire dome, creating an immersive environment that transforms concerts into multi-sensory events. The venue’s design allows for flexible seating configurations, including standing-room areas that can increase capacity for certain events.
The LED system’s high resolution and brightness ensure visibility even in daylight conditions, expanding the venue’s usability for various event types. This flexibility in both capacity and display capability makes the MSG Sphere a model for future venues.
